Essay Topics

Write an essay for ONE of the following topics:

Essay Topic 1

Joe and Sunny have a mutual attraction.

Part 1) Why are they attracted to one another? How does their attraction make later conflicts more dramatic?

Part 2) What do others think of their mutual attraction? Do the others accept it? Why or why not?

Part 3) How do the qualities they find attractive in one another also lead to the conflict between them?

Essay Topic 2

Two important symbols set up how non-observant the Jewish family is.

Part 1) What are these two symbols? How do they show how unobservant they are?

Part 2) What is the significance of these two symbols?

Part 3) How are these symbols used throughout the rest of the play? Why are they used?

Essay Topic 3

Lala and her family have drifted from the traditions of their faith.

Part 1) How do you know this? Why have they drifted?

Part 2) Do they return to their faith at some point in the play? Why or why not?

Part 3) Will any of the family members ever truly understand what it means to practice religion? Why or why not?
